The State of Education Procurement
Operating as a bid consultant within Edinburgh’s education sector requires far more than standard proposal management; it demands rigorous strategic positioning across highly regulated frameworks. Whether targeting the City of Edinburgh Council's school estate contracts or higher education agreements through APUC (Advanced Procurement for Universities and Colleges), consultants must navigate the stringent requirements of the Procurement Reform (Scotland) Act 2014. A critical component of this is embedding Fair Work First criteria and localized Community Benefits into the core win themes. Buyers in this region do not just evaluate price and baseline service delivery; they scrutinize how a supplier's offering aligns with Scotland's Curriculum for Excellence and institutional Net Zero targets.
The primary pain point for strategic bid consultants in this niche is the complexity of the bid/no-bid decision process. When evaluating an SPD (Single Procurement Document Scotland), consultants often struggle to quantify a supplier's true competitive advantage against entrenched incumbents, particularly when qualitative scoring matrices heavily favor localized social value. Differentiating a bid requires architecting a narrative that proves pedagogical value while remaining commercially viable under tight Scottish Government funding constraints. Without deep, data-driven insights into buyer preferences, consultants risk advising clients to pursue unwinnable tenders, wasting critical bid budgets.
